Where do you find supplemental essays on common app?

There are two ways you can access a college’s Writing Supplement. From the Dashboard, click on the ‘Show more details’ link for the school of interest. You can then click on the Writing Supplement link to be taken to that section to complete.

Can you submit supplements after Common App?

For most schools, submitting the Common App is not quite the end of the process. You’ll also need to submit your school-specific supplement, and you cannot do so until your Common App itself is submitted. Look for the school to which you just submitted an application.

What happens after I submit my common app?

Following the submission of your application, all of the information you have provided is sent to the Common Application’s data warehouse where it is electronically distributed to the schools on your college list. From there, university admissions offices are able to download all of your information securely.

How do I know if I submitted my common app?

Application Statuses To help you keep track of your application and all materials, click Check Status at the top of the application dashboard. Recommendations are immediately updated once received from your recommender.

Who can see my common app?

You can allow your counselor to see a PDF preview of your in-progress application. Under their name, you can click on the ‘Enable Preview’ button to grant them preview access. Please note that a Counselor cannot edit or change your application in any way; they may only see the answers you have provided.

Can I view my college application?

Here’s how to gain access to your own admissions records. Just contact the admissions office at your university and request access under FERPA to any documents they have, which they are legally obligated to provide within 45 days.

Can I access my college application?

Under the rules of FERPA, you are only allowed to access your records at an institution where you are a student, so this will torpedo your quest to find out what admission officials at colleges that rejected you might have said. You can, however, access your file at the college you attend.
